> Then I looked in stderr.2 and found this:

FYI this is a few bugs and bug fixes ganging up to crash.

The first bug was (it is fixed since *2016* - https://github.com/gnuradio/gnuradio/commit/11973c64437683cc99c48eae9eb4db8234f1ac42#diff-6afde48a2246887a22e0cbe0a675e1c8) in GNUradio #528.

A work around was added to rtl-sdr (which is the "Trying to fill up.." message) which is at https://github.com/osmocom/gr-osmosdr/blob/5ecfa255d299b9b4842ccd09a02892a853fcd5a7/lib/source_impl.cc#L413

The second bug is p25_demodulator.py crashing because it doesn't detect self.decim is zero.

It looks like gr-osmosdr now has the work around removed (since July 2017) - https://github.com/osmocom/gr-osmosdr/commit/ea6b356cfda8a90fa6d727fcc13aae60547962a2

tl;dr:
- It didn't find your hardware, check your VM pass through
- Update gr-osmosdr to get less confusing errors :)
